  • NON-TOXIC FLEXIBLE VINYL RESIN in 6 COLOURS
    PVC FLEXIBLE SKIRTING 120 height 120 mm, is a very strong profile ideal for easily achieving special, attractive, superior finishes. Installation recommended with glue or silicone. Easy to install, the shaped edges ensure perfect adhesion to the surface. The projecting rounded flange covers the terminal expansion joint. Colours: white - light grey - dark grey - dark brown - brown - black.
